Abstract

A large amount of materials science research in which the vertical channels of the core and reflector are used is being conducted in the IR-8 reactor. To develop experimental programs for reactor research it is of fundamental importance to know not only these parameters but also how they change. The present article validates the possibility of using the computational data obtained with the MCU-PTR code to analyze the neutron-physical parameters and determine the conditions of irradiation of the experimental samples. A comparative analysis of the experimental and computational data shows that it is possible to use this method. The method is now used for tracking the operation of the reactor computationally, pre-reactor determination of the conditions of irradiation of the experimental samples, tracking computationally the conditions of irradiation of the experimental samples of the vessel materials used in nuclear-power facilities and other experiments in IR-8.
